WebSelf-reactive chemicals are thermally unstable liquid or solid chemicals that can undergo exothermic decomposition without interacting with oxygen. Self-reactive chemicals can start decomposing due to: Heat. Contact with acids. Contact with heavy metal compounds. Contact with bases. Friction. Web8.4 Spontaneously Combustible. Print Page. Spontaneously combustible materials are also known as pyrophorics; these chemicals can spontaneously ignite in the presence of air, some are reactive with water vapor, and most are reactive with oxygen. Two common examples are tert-Butyllithium under Hexanes and White Phosphorus.
